在现代网络中,用户对于隐私保护和安全性的关注不断增加。在这样的背景下,Clash作为一种流行的网络代理工具,其功能与应用也逐渐被广泛认知。本文将专注于Clash中的伪装Host功能,帮助用户深入理解这一重要特性,并提供详细的配置指南。
什么是Clash伪装Host
Clash伪装Host是一种技术手段,让用户能在网络请求中伪装自己真实的目标主机地址。这一功能的主要目的是为了解决那些被GFW(Great Firewall of China)限制访问的问题,即对于某些特定域名进行伪装,从而实现接入未被限制的互联网,以确保网络访问的畅通和自由。
Clash的基本功能
在了解伪装Host之前,首先要清楚以下Clash的基本功能:
- 订阅功能:支持自动订阅规则,自同步更新
- 规则选择:支持多种不同的规则,做到灵活选择
- 模式切换:可根据不同需求,选择全局、规则或直连模式
- 流量统计:可视化展示流量的使用情况
为什么需要使用伪装Host?
使用伪装Host有多个重要理由:
- 提高安全性:通过伪装真实目标主机地址来提高隐私
- 穿墙功能:能有效应对网络言论审查,突破地域封锁
- 可定制化:用户可以自由选择要伪装的主机记录
Clash伪装Host的配置方法
步骤一:安装Clash
- 在各大平台下载Clash工具,比如Windows、macOS、Android和Linux等。
- 解压并安装相关依赖,如必须的Net Filter或者Dart SDK。
步骤二:编辑配置文件
- 找到并打开config.yaml文件。
- 在该文件中,找到代理配置部分。
- 在以下Proxy部分添加伪装Host配置:
yaml- name: “my_proxy”
type: ss
server: your_server_address
port: your_port
cipher: your_cipher
password: your_password
fake-ip: true
alters:- ‘伪装之主机.example.com’
- name: “my_proxy”
步骤三:配置规则
-
在同一配置文件下,设置对应的使用条件:
yaml
rules:- DOMAIN-KEYWORD,朋友圈,Proxy
- DOMAIN-SUFFIX,example.com,Proxy
-
保存文件并重新启动Clash,使新配置生效。
常见问题解答(FAQ)
1. 如何检测伪装Host是否生效?
用户可通过以下几种方式检测效果:
- 使用ping命令检查目标地址是否能连接
- 利用工具如Fiddler、Charles等监控请求,查看实际请求的Host后台
- 通过访问国际网站,多尝试不同的域名以检测结果。
2. Clash角色与其他代理工具的区别是什么?
- Clash是一个基于规则的代理工具,支持自定义规则;不同于一般的VPN工具,其灵活性更高。
- Clash还具备高效性与兼容性,可在不同环境和需求中进行切换。
3. 是否所有网络请求都能被伪装?
- 并不是所有请求都能通过伪装Host进行。通常HTTPS请求可以受益于伪装,而某些特定的条件和情形下无法生效,比如内部网络请求。
总结与展望
使用Clash伪装Host功能不仅确保了网络的稳定和安全,还有助于规避通过网络审查。然而,用户在配置时应对相关的技术手段有一定了解,以确保达到最优效果。随着技术的不断更新,Clash和伪装Host功能将不断完善,希望未来能为广大用户提供更便捷的网络访问体验。
正文完